EDITORS COMMENTS
This photograph takes us back in time to the late 19th century, offering a glimpse into the ancient world of Athens, Greece. The image showcases the majestic Caryatid porch of the Erechtheion, an iconic temple located on the Acropolis. The intricate architecture of this historic site is truly awe-inspiring. The delicate details carved into the stone columns are a testament to the skill and craftsmanship of ancient Greek architects. Standing tall and proud, these statuesque maidens known as caryatids support the weight of the structure with grace and elegance. Despite being captured over a century ago, this photograph still manages to convey a sense of grandeur and beauty that has stood the test of time. The ruins surrounding the temple serve as a reminder of its rich history and archaeological significance.
